There are many issues that need to be addressed if you want to fast. First, you shouldn’t do it if you are in your growing years or teen years, you should not deprive your body of daily nutrients at this crucial time. Second, you need to know if you are hypoglycemic (low blood sugar), if so, you would need to do a different type of fasting, not “just water” fasting. Third, you need to know what you are doing, what you’re trying to cleanse/detoxify, how to ween yourself down and bring yourself back to normal meals, etc. You should not “just stop eating” for a few days then start up again, you need to be smart about it.Some people want to detoxify because they read about it, see it on tv, their friends do it, etc but you need to truly be “toxic” to need to “detoxify”. You can detoxify by eating healthy and stopping fast food, greasy deep fried foods, processed foods, etc. You do not NEED to fast to detoxify. Fresh fruits/vegetables, whole grains, minimal dairy, no trans fats or saturated fats, eating more organic/less “treated” foods, etc. Don’t do it unless you KNOW what you are doing or are under the guidance of a professional (nutritionalist, herbalist, doctor, nurse, etc) – do not go by the recomendations of “friends”.

Periodic short-term fasts are fine…and probably good for you. 5 day water fasts is a bit extreme. For one thing when you go more than a day or two you are at risk of slowing down your metabolism. If weight management is an issue for you, that could make the problem worse. I’d recommend a one-day fast once a week or a two-day fast once a month.
